We are recruiting for a Physiotherapist - Rotational who shares our vision to be trusted to provide consistently outstanding care and exemplary service to our patients. We offer excellent opportunities for new graduates and experienced Band 5s wanting to enhance their skills. We offer strong professional leadership and rotations across East and North Hertfordshire, working in partnership with Hertfordshire Community NHS Trust. At the heart of everything we do are our core values: Include, Respect, and Improve.
Participate in the Band 5 Rotational scheme which involves musculoskeletal outpatients, community care, acute orthopaedics, respiratory care including critical care, care of the elderly, acute medicine, stroke rehabilitation and medical rehabilitation. You will assess, diagnose and treat your own patient caseload and maintain records as an autonomous practitioner, while communicating with medical and nursing staff, social workers, other health professionals, patients, relatives and carers. You will be responsible for your own patient caseload and work predominantly without direct supervision, with regular indirect clinical supervision through formal training, clinical reasoning sessions, peer review, case conferences and reflective practices. You will also participate in the physiotherapy emergency respiratory on-call service.
About East and North Hertfordshire Teaching NHS Trust: we provide general and specialist services with around 6,000 staff, and we are committed to flexible and innovative ways of working. We run The Lister Hospital, New QEII, Hertford County and Mount Vernon Cancer Centre, and continue to transform to deliver high-quality, compassionate care.
